A prominent Belgian politician who has played a key role in the political landscape since the 1990s. Serving as a member of the Flemish Parliament, held leadership positions within the political party Vlaams Belang. Advocated for Flemish nationalism and has been involved in various political campaigns focusing on issues such as immigration and Belgian federalism. Engaged in public-speaking events and has contributed to numerous debates regarding Flemish autonomy.

Hiroshi Amano

Japanese physicist, Nobel Prize laureate
Born
September 11th, 1960 65 years ago

A physicist and academic contributed significantly to the development of blue light-emitting diodes (LEDs). Discovery of efficient blue LEDs enabled advancements in lighting technology and display systems. The research played a critical role in the creation of energy-efficient lighting solutions and contributed to various applications in electronics and communication. Co-recipient of the 2014 Nobel Prize in Physics, received recognition alongside two other scientists for the invention of efficient blue LEDs. This achievement has had a transformative impact on lighting and displays, influencing a wide range of industries and applications.
